More About HfT Leipzig
HFT Leipzig (Hochschule für Telekommunikation Leipzig) is a specialized higher education institution in Germany that concentrates on telecommunications, ICT, and adjacent engineering and business subjects. Its programs are oriented toward technical and operational roles in telecommunications operators, IT service providers, network equipment vendors, and related enterprise environments. Graduates typically work in areas such as network planning, systems engineering, IT operations, software development, and technical project management, where an understanding of communications infrastructures and protocols is required.
The university’s curriculum integrates electrical engineering, computer science, and business-oriented modules with a focus on modern telecommunications systems. This typically includes courses on digital communications, network architectures, signal processing, switching and routing concepts, and IT systems administration. In addition, modules in economics, management, and regulatory frameworks support roles that span both technical and commercial aspects of telecom and ICT operations. For enterprise stakeholders, the institution’s profile aligns with workforce development in fields such as network engineering, IT infrastructure management, and communications service design.
HFT Leipzig hosts laboratories and teaching environments that mirror real-world communications and IT infrastructures. These environments commonly incorporate networking hardware and software, server and client systems, and simulation or measurement tools used to analyze and configure communication links and IT services. Such labs support topics like IP-based networking (network infrastructure), wireless communication systems, and service platforms relevant to enterprise data and voice communication. This practical focus gives students exposure to architectures and protocols widely used in industry, such as layered network models and standard telecommunications signaling and transport mechanisms.
The institution engages in applied research in telecommunications and ICT, often in cooperation with industry partners. Research topics may include network performance, Quality of Service (QoS), security aspects in communication systems (cybersecurity), and digital services supporting business processes.
